How Your Listing Data Is Shared

This is important to understand: when you list a property with us, your listing data is submitted to the Multiple Listing Service (MLS). Once submitted, that listing content becomes part of the MLS’s database and is governed by the MLS’s rules.

Your listing information will also be syndicated to public real estate websites such as Zillow, Realtor.com, Homes.com, and others. We do not control how those third-party websites display, store, or use the listing data.

Your listing and property photos will also be automatically displayed on our website at listnowrealty.com. Your personal contact information is not included. You may request that we remove your listing from our website at any time.

How Your Contact Information Is Used

Your personal contact information (name, phone, and email) is never displayed on public-facing websites. It is shared only in the following limited ways:

  • MLS agent remarks: Your contact information is included in the agent-only remarks section of your MLS listing, which is visible only to licensed real estate agents with MLS access.
  • Direct inquiries: When someone calls or contacts us asking about your property, we provide your contact information so they can reach you directly.
  • Live answering service: We use a live answering service that has access to your contact information so they can provide it to callers asking about your property.
  • ShowingTime: If you request that we set up ShowingTime for your listing, your contact information is shared with ShowingTime to facilitate showing requests.
